Understanding Mindfulness in a Digital Age

As technology becomes increasingly woven into our daily lives, understanding mindfulness in a digital age is essential for maintaining mental well-being. With constant notifications and relentless information flow, it’s easy to feel overwhelmed. Mindfulness helps you pause, reflect, and reconnect with the present moment, allowing you to navigate this digital landscape more effectively.

You can start by recognizing how technology affects your daily routine. Notice when you’re mindlessly scrolling through social media or checking emails out of habit. Instead of letting these habits control you, practice being intentional with your screen time. Set boundaries—designate specific times to check your devices and stick to them. This creates space for mindfulness in your day.

Incorporating mindfulness practices, like meditation or deep-breathing exercises, can help ground you amidst digital distractions. Even a few minutes of focused breathing can center your thoughts and reduce stress.

Embrace the idea that it’s okay to disconnect; giving yourself permission to step away from screens fosters a healthier relationship with technology. Ultimately, by cultivating mindfulness, you’ll enhance your resilience, clarity, and overall mental well-being in this fast-paced digital environment.

Essential Tools for Virtual Mindfulness

Incorporating mindfulness into your virtual life can be streamlined with the right tools. First, consider meditation apps like Headspace or Calm. They offer guided sessions tailored to various needs, whether you’re a beginner or more experienced. These apps can help you establish a consistent practice, even on your most hectic days.

Another essential tool is a digital journal, such as Day One or Journey. Writing down your thoughts and feelings can enhance self-awareness and provide clarity. Set aside a few minutes each day to reflect on your experiences, allowing you to process emotions effectively.

You might also explore virtual reality (VR) mindfulness experiences. Apps like TRIPP or Oculus Venues allow you to immerse yourself in calming environments, promoting relaxation and focus. This can be especially helpful if you struggle to find peace in your physical surroundings.

Lastly, consider using timers or reminders to prompt mindfulness breaks during your day. Tools like Forest or Focus@Will can help you stay committed to your practice by encouraging short, focused intervals of mindfulness.

With these tools, you can cultivate a more mindful approach to your digital interactions and daily life.

Creating a Mindfulness Routine at Home

Establishing a mindfulness routine at home can transform your daily life. By incorporating mindfulness training online practices into your schedule, you create a space for mental clarity and emotional balance. Start small; dedicate just a few minutes each day to mindfulness.

To help you structure your routine, consider the following table:

Time of Day Activity Duration
Morning Breathing exercises 5 minutes
Afternoon Mindful walking 10 minutes
Evening Journaling 10 minutes
Before Bed Guided meditation 15 minutes

By allocating specific times for each activity, you make mindfulness a priority. Choose a quiet spot in your home where you can focus without distractions. Additionally, adjust the duration based on your comfort level.

Consistency is key; aim to practice daily, even if it’s just for a few minutes. You’ll find that these moments of mindfulness can significantly enhance your overall well-being, helping you navigate life’s challenges with greater ease. Remember, it’s about quality, not quantity, so be patient with yourself as you develop this new habit.

Overcoming Common Virtual Distractions

In a world filled with constant notifications and digital distractions, staying focused on mindfulness can be challenging. To overcome these hurdles, you need to create an environment conducive to concentration. Start by silencing notifications on your devices. This simple step can significantly reduce interruptions during your mindfulness practice.

Next, establish a dedicated space for your sessions. Find a quiet corner in your home where you can escape the hustle and bustle. Keep this area free from distractions, like clutter or excessive technology. You might also consider using apps that promote focus, blocking distracting websites during your mindfulness time.

It’s also vital to set clear boundaries. Communicate with those around you about your mindfulness schedule. Let them know when you’re unavailable, so they respect your time.

If you find your mind wandering, gently redirect your attention back to your breath or your chosen focal point. You may face challenges, but remember, it’s all part of the process.

With practice, you’ll learn to minimize distractions and cultivate a deeper mindfulness experience in this digital age. By taking these steps, you’ll enhance your journey toward clarity and presence.
